Kaip išspręsti problemas su WebGL?

Intro mentoriui

nėra palaikomas. Taip nebūtinai yra, tai gali būti tiesiog naršyklės nustatymų klausimas. Detalios instrukcijos, kaip visa tai išspęsti yra čia.

1. Nueikite į http://get.webgl.org tam, kad pasitikrintumėte, ar WebGL iš tikrųjų veikia jūsų naršyklėje. Jeigu viskas gerai, turėtumėte matyti besisukantį kubą, kaip šiame paveiksliuke:

2. Patikrinkite savo naršyklės nustatymus.

a. Google Chrome

  • Nukopijuokite šią nuorodą į savo naršyklę: Chrome://flags
  • Pasirinkite “Enable” prie šio nustatymo: “Override software rendering list”, kaip parodyta apačioje
  • Paspauskite “Relaunch Now” puslapio apačioje tam, kad perkrautumėte naršyklę su naujais nustatymais.
  • Jei nepadės prieš tai buvusios instrukcijos, galite pabandyti išjungti (“disable”) šį nustatymą: “Use hardware acceleration when available” Advance Settings for Chrome skiltyje ir tada iš naujo paleisti naršyklę.

b. Firefox

  • Nukopijuokite šią nuorodą į savo naršyklę: About:config
  • Pažymėkite “I’ll be careful, I promise!”
  • Suraskite WebGL
  • Nustatykite Webgl.force-enabled į true
  • Iš naujo atidarykite naršyklę

c. Safari

  • Įjunkite “Develop menu” nuėję į Safari -> Preferences -> Advanced -> Pasirinkite meniu “Show Develop menu” 
  • Pasirinkite Enable WebGL “Develop menu” skiltyje
  • Iš naujo atidarykite naršyklę